South Korea to send team to North Korea to prepare for opening of liaison office

South Korean officials and civilian experts will visit North Korea today,... to prepare for the opening of a liaison office in the North's border city of Kaesong.
According to Seoul's Unification Ministry,... the 14-member team,... lead by Vice Unification Minister Chun Hae-sung will inspect relevant facilities.
Last week,... the two Koreas agreed to open a liaison office in anticipation of increased cross-border exchanges.
The two Koreans operated the joint industrial complex in Kaesong between 2004 and 2016.
During its time in operation, it was largely hailed as a successful example of economic cooperation between the two Koreas.
